CypNest - How to Handle Broken Lines in Parts

When importing part drawings, we may occasionally find isolated broken lines in them.

There are three common solutions to this issue:

1.If the broken lines are redundant, select and delete them. Then click the Identify Parts button.

2.If the broken lines need to be cut, select the entire graphic and click the Set as Part button.

3.If the broken lines are intended as marking lines:

For a small number of broken lines: Select the target broken lines, click Cut First on the right side to assign them to the default marking layer. Finally, click the Identify Parts button.

 

For a large number of broken lines: Click the Select button and choose the Select Open Graphic to select all broken lines at once. Then click Cut First on the right side to assign them to the default marking layer. Finally, click the Identify Parts button to complete the process.
